Ed Guiney
Known for: Production
Born: February 17, 1966 in Dublin, Ireland
Edward Michael Guiney is an Irish-American film producer, co-founder, and co-CEO of the film and television production company Element Pictures. He won a British Academy Film Award and was nominated for four more in Best Film and Outstanding British Film for The Favourite, The Wonder and Poor Things.
